K. Ananda Rao vs Sri S.S. Rawat, Ias

Citation / case number
AIRONLINE 2019 SC 706
Court
Supreme Court of India
Petitioner
K. Ananda Rao
Respondent
Sri S.S. Rawat, Ias
Author
Uday Umesh Lalit
Bench
M.R. Shah, Uday Umesh Lalit

Judgment text excerpt

The Supreme Court addressed multiple contempt petitions arising from civil appeals concerning the non-compliance of earlier court orders by the respondents. The court emphasized the importance of adhering to judicial directives and the consequences of contempt. Ultimately, the court found the respondents in contempt and imposed penalties to ensure compliance with its orders.
